[RFC PATCH 2/4] PCI: Add "pci=iommu_passthrough=" parameter for iommu passthrough

From: Lu Baolu
Date: Wed Jan 01 2020 - 00:32:35 EST


The new parameter takes a list of devices separated by a semicolon.
Each device specified will have its iommu_passthrough bit in struct
device set. This is very similar to the existing 'disable_acs_redir'
parameter.

+ iommu_passthrough=<pci_dev>[; ...]
+ Specify one or more PCI devices (in the format
+ specified above) separated by semicolons.
+ Each device specified will bypass IOMMU DMA
+ translation.

+static const char *iommu_passthrough_param;
+bool pci_iommu_passthrough_match(struct pci_dev *dev)
+{
+ int ret = 0;
+ const char *p = iommu_passthrough_param;
+
+ if (!p)
+ return false;
+
+ while (*p) {
+ ret = pci_dev_str_match(dev, p, &p);
+ if (ret < 0) {
+ pr_info_once("PCI: Can't parse iommu_passthrough parameter: %s\n",
+ iommu_passthrough_param);
+
+ break;
+ } else if (ret == 1) {
+ pci_info(dev, "PCI: IOMMU passthrough\n");
+ return true;
+ }
+
+ if (*p != ';' && *p != ',') {
+ /* End of param or invalid format */
+ break;
+ }
+ p++;
+ }
+
+ return false;
+}
